Non-sparking funnels are designed to prevent ignition in hazardous environments. The initial investment may seem high; however, the long-term savings in accident prevention and compliance can outweigh these costs significantly.
Non-sparking funnels are made from materials that do not produce sparks when struck against hard surfaces. Commonly used in industries involving flammable liquids, they help to prevent on-site accidents and maintain safety protocols.
Opting for a low-cost funnel may save money upfront but could lead to severe consequences, including accidents and regulatory fines. In fact, a study by the National Safety Council suggests that the average cost of workplace accidents can exceed $40,000.
A manufacturing company in Texas reported a 60% reduction in safety incidents after switching to non-sparking funnels. By investing in quality equipment, they not only enhanced employee safety but also reduced insurance costs significantly.
